Ling Started as a Love Story
The origins of Ling lie in the desire for connection. German-born Simon Bacher wanted to communicate with his Thai friends and family but couldn’t find reliable resources for learning the Thai language. Determined to overcome this barrier, Simon and his wife Kanyarat decided to create their own language-learning app. This marked the beginning of Ling’s mission to bring people together through language.
